Has NE1 tried YearOne painting products?

My 84 SC is missing some interior panels + door panels. Fear not! I have a parts car, but interior is blue. My plan is to paint the vinyl door panels as well as the missing pieces tan. Found a whole bunch of painting products at YearOne to make this happen. Has anyone tried their products? Seems this will be a cheaper alternative over buying new panels.

Yes, I did about two years ago. Repainted the back cover that goes over the hatch motor and stuff. Very satisfied. If I remember correctly you have to use a cleaner, then a primer, and then paint. Looks great, however that area really gets no wear. It seems pretty durable though.
